If the car keeps spinning its wheel, if you keep forcing it, the clutch will wear out! in Tetun
Kareta platina hanesan ne'e, se ó obriga nafatin, orsida sinta embreajen mohu!

Conditionals
se / karik — conditionals
se'se' opens a definite conditional ('if X, then Y'). 'karik' sits at the end of a clause and hedges it ('perhaps'); it can also mark an uncertain conditional.
